I teach at 7 schools and see approximately 325 students. 100% of my students receive assistance with breakfast and lunches. A high percentage of my students are living without technology at home and resources for learning. My 325 curious and energetic Kindergarten, first, and second graders need your help with resources for learning.
My students are young, potentially gifted students who love a challenge.
They want more experiences, difficult tasks, and a classroom where they can try, fail, and try again.
My Project
My students have tablets, but I do not. An iPad is needed to be able to demonstrate for them, help them visually see the steps in getting to a site, show them how to present ideas, and present which tools they may use to show their learning.
I need an iPad to model how learning will take place for my students.
In many of the setting where I teach there isn't even a white board. This iPad will help my students to understand better and navigate their learning visually. They will be able to see their learning activities displayed for all. This command center will give them a place to send their ideas, record their answers, join a digital community, and show their learning in new and different ways.
